Firstly, let's explore and understand what practices can make your spoken English interview go wrong.รย�
Avoid Slang: Refrain from using informal language or slang, the spoken English module in any English prolificacy examination requires you to present yourself with utmost professionalism.
Minimise Fillers: Reduce the use of fillers like "um," "uh," and "like." in case, during the interview you lack the right answer, pause briefly and construct the right answer rather than using filler words.
Limit Complex Vocabulary: Use straightforward, clear language in your visa interview, and steer clear of jargon or overly complex terms to ensure understanding.
Don't Interrupt: Wait for the interviewer to finish speaking before responding, as interrupting can come across as disrespectful and rude.
Avoid Negative Language: Frame your answers positively, avoiding complaints or negative comments about past experiences to leave a favourable impression.
Don't Memorize Response: Prepare thoroughly but aim to speak naturally and spontaneously, avoiding a robotic tone during your visa interview.

Practice Pronunciation: Enunciate clearly and accurately by using language learning apps or online resources to enhance your pronunciation skills.
Use Polite Language: Incorporate polite phrases such as "please," "thank you," and "excuse me" to show respect through your words and tone.
Maintain Eye Contact: Establish eye contact to demonstrate confidence, ensuring it is natural and not prolonged to avoid discomfort.
Speak Clearly and Slowly: Take your time to articulate clearly, ensuring your message is understood without rushing your words during the interview.
Prepare Responses: Anticipate common questions, and practice concise and relevant answers to showcase clarity and preparation in your communication skills.
Listen Actively: During the interview, demonstrate engagement by attentively listening to questions and providing nods or verbal acknowledgements when appropriate.
